Discuss the characteristics and significance of the asteroid belt in the Solar System.

The asteroid belt is a region located between the orbits of Mars and Jupiter, where numerous small rocky objects called asteroids orbit the Sun. These asteroids range in size from small boulders to dwarf planets like Ceres. The asteroid belt is significant as it provides insights into the early history of the Solar System and the processes involved in planet formation. It is also a source of meteorites that occasionally reach Earth.
